
| | | Father of groom
Otto Haegemans, born in Kortenberg (Belgium), residing in Huldenberg, marichal by profession Mother of groom
Claire Luppens, born in Overijse (Belgium), residing in Huldenberg |
| | | Groom
Michel Haegemans, born on August 20, 1772 in Huldenberg (Belgium), 37 years old, jeune homme, residing in Huldenberg, marichal by profession Bride
Jeanne Catherine Gillis, born on October 1, 1769 in Huldenberg (Belgium), 38 years old, jeune fille, residing in Huldenberg |
| | | Father of bride
Jaque Gillis, born in Huldenberg (Belgium), residing in Huldenberg, cultivateur by profession Mother of bride
Marie Dewit, born in Vossem (Belgium), residing in Huldenberg |
Witnesses
- Jean Baptiste Haegemans, 48 years old, residing in Huldenberg, maréchal by profession
- Pierre Gillis, 41 years old, residing in Huldenberg, cultivateur by profession
- Jean Baptiste Decaffmyer, 41 years old, residing in Huldenberg, cultivateur by profession
- Guilleaume Joseph Nowé, 41 years old, residing in Huldenberg, cabaretier by profession
Source citation
State Archives of Belgium (Leuven) in Leuven (Belgium), Civil registration marriages
Burgerlijke stand Provincie Vlaams Brabant, Leuven, August 2, 1809, record number 6
